Lead Project Manager

McKesson

Lead Project Manager responsible for corporate finance project execution at McKesson. Overseeing large, complex programs with focus on operational and financial impacts.

About the role

Key responsibilities & impact
  • Lead the planning, execution and successful delivery of highly complex programs across Corporate Finance functions such as technology implementations, and transformations
  • Ensure adherence to project goals, timelines and budget – primarily supporting the business in remaining focused on high priority capabilities and managing scope-creep with a rigorous strategic approach
  • Coordinate and manage multiple vendors and stakeholders to ensure on-time delivery, within budget and in accordance with agreed upon quality standards
  • Prepare regular project status reports, deliver progress updates to stakeholders, lead SteerCo meetings and maintain project documentation and artifacts as needed
  • Manage project budgets, track expenditures and ensure cost-effectiveness throughout the project lifecycle by leading the business towards effective prioritization
  • Identify and mitigate project risks, proactively addressing issues that may impact project success
  • Identify opportunities for process improvement and best practices, driving efficiency and effectiveness in project delivery
  • Foster strong cross-functional collaboration and working relationships with various teams and stakeholders to ensure successful project outcomes

Requirements

What you’ll need
  • Degree or equivalent and typically requires 10+ years of relevant experience
  • Lean/Six Sigma certification (Black Belt) and/or Project Management Institute (PMP) certification is a plus
  • Experience as a project manager over large, complex, and Enterprise-wide technology implementations
  • Expert level Project Management understanding and strong financial business acumen
  • Demonstrated ability to motivate, influence and gain commitment at all levels of the organization
  • Ability to understand and identify the connections between specific projects and the key strategic objectives
  • Ability to think through, organize and assist with leading multiple projects and tasks concurrently
  • Ability to facilitate and communicate effectively in a hybrid environment
  • Strong interpersonal and consulting skills – ability to assess needs, collaborate and deliver practical solutions that drive results; an excellent listener that seeks to understand multiple viewpoints; effective at influencing, facilitating, and problem solving
  • Build strong and trusting relationships across multiple teams and departments and collaborate with business leaders to execute plans
